How laboratory automation supports modern scientific applications

Laboratory automation applications span the full spectrum of modern scientific workflows—from sample preparation and screening to cell culture, bioproduction, and quality control. By integrating robotic systems, workflow scheduling software, and connected data platforms, laboratories can automate repetitive processes while improving throughput, reproducibility, and traceability. From automating a single instrument to implementing total lab automation across interconnected workflows, these solutions enable scalable, data-driven research environments. As scientific demands grow more complex, laboratory automation plays a critical role in accelerating discovery and enabling smarter, faster science.

Synthetic biology

Automate construct design, cell line maintenance, and product extraction, purification, and characterization.


Drug discovery

Manage and screen compound libraries, pick hits, run secondary assays, and profile active compounds with precision and speed.


Biologics

Support large molecule workflows from cell culture to purification and LC/MS-based characterization.


Analytical characterization

Integrate LC or LC/MS into your automated workflow for consistent, high-quality analytical data.


Next-generation sequencing

Automate DNA/RNA extraction, library preparation, fragmentation, and pooling for streamlined sequencing workflows.


ELISA

Automate plate assembly, incubation, and detection on a compact, integrated, workstation.


Cellular biology

Automate cell cultures workflows including feeding, splitting and incubation-maintaining optimal conditions with precision.


Pathogen screening

Automate sample processing for qPCR or antibody detection, with scalable workstations to match your throughput needs.
